[5], Instead, Congress passed the Organic Act of 1871, which revoked the individual charters of the cities of Washington and Georgetown and combined them with Washington County to create a unified territorial government for the entire District of Columbia. [10] In 1874, Congress replaced the District's quasi-elected territorial government with an appointed three-member Board of Commissioners. The adoption of the Thirteenth, Fourteenth, and Fifteenth Amendments to the Constitution extended civil and legal protections to former slaves and prohibited states from disenfranchising voters on account of race, color, or previous condition of servitude. Forces in some states were at work, however, to deny black citizens their legal rights. 22, 17 Stat. Let us know!. According to the Indian Appropriation Act of March 3, 1871, no longer was any group of Indians in the United States recognized as an independent nation by the federal government.
